Description
The purpose of this notice is to initiate market engagement, and it is not being used as a call for competition.
This PIN is intended to:
1. Inform the market of the upcoming procurement process for the Generation 2, Wave 3 T Levels, being commissioned by the Institute for Apprenticeships and Technical Education (IfATE) (and therefore enable the market/potential suppliers to begin to plan for this); and
2. Advise as to the upcoming market engagement event via Microsoft Teams on 11th September 2024 at 4pm, which will include a presentation on the Strategic Discussion of Commercial Principles. There will also be one to one sessions offered where suppliers can meet with the Commercial team.
This notice is in respect of the below T Levels;
-Maintenance, Installation and Repair for Engineering and Manufacturing
-Engineering, Manufacturing, Process and Control
-Design and Development for Engineering and Manufacturing
-Management and Administration
-Finance
-Accounting
Further details about how to book one to one slots and attend the presentation can be found in the Information Memorandum accessible at https://procontract.due-north.com/register
Please note: Learner numbers underpinning these estimated contract values will be updated prior to the ITT based upon the 2024/25 cohort that are not yet available.
All contracts will be public services concession contracts, currently governed by the Concession Contract Regulations 2016, however, the procurement when launched, will be governed by the Procurement Act 2023, as defined at section 8 of the Act, to the extent that the same apply to services which such contract (or contracts) would relate.
